From Idea to App Store: The Mobile Dev Pipeline
Crafting an innovative mobile application is a multifaceted journey that involves several stages. The process typically begins with ideation, where developers forge ideas for apps that solve user needs. Once a concept is solidified, the next phase entails designing. During this stage, developers construct rough drafts of the app's interface and functionality to demonstrate its core elements. Rigorous testing is then implemented to detect any bugs or problems.
Once the app has been thoroughly tested and refined, it's time for deployment. This involves submitting the app to relevant app stores, such as Apple's App Store or Google Play Store. After review by the platform, the app becomes obtainable to users worldwide. Ongoing support and maintenance are crucial for ensuring the app's longevity. Developers often monitor user feedback and integrate changes to enhance the app's functionality and user experience.
